Transaction 2e8f243bf992c4c60172a5e4b0d3dfe3a21cdd52f9b876befbda33cc3e40f03e
1 Input
2 Outputs
- 2e8f243bf992c4c60172a5e4b0d3dfe3a21cdd52f9b876befbda33cc3e40f03e:0
- 2e8f243bf992c4c60172a5e4b0d3dfe3a21cdd52f9b876befbda33cc3e40f03e:1
value 8019859
address 16CTtCcYJ9L9mexjFNWjVTwb7GFFEZgjbT
value 5000000
address 17ybKGXS7s4eqqHveHgcafjuS9eZbck3th